降雨条件下河流冲刷型滑坡的基本特征及滑动机制分析——以四川宣汉樊哙大桥滑坡为例

摘    要:以宣汉樊哙大桥滑坡为例,分析降雨条件下河流冲刷型滑坡的滑动机制。在对滑坡区的地质条件、滑坡的基本特征和滑坡的变形过程等综合分析的基础上,探讨了降雨条件下河流冲刷型滑坡发育特征及形成机理。分析表明,降水对降雨条件下河流冲刷型滑坡起到了双重作用:一方面,河水对坡脚的浸泡、冲刷;另一方面,强降雨形成的雨水沿着坡面渗入坡体,在滑体与基岩接触面上形成滞水带,受地下水的浸泡泥岩极易软化,强度大幅降低,促使坡体滑动。深入研究樊哙滑坡的基本特征和成灾机制,对西南地区临河型滑坡的预防与治理提供一定的技术支持和借鉴作用。

Analysis of the Basic Characteristics and Formation Mechanism of River Erosion-Type Landslides under Rainfal Conditions as Exemplified by Fankuai Daqiao Landslide in Xuanhan, Sichuan Province

Abstract:At 21:30 p.m.of July 16, 2009, a slide took place in Dafengtan of Gufeng Village of Fankuai Town of Xuanhan, Sichuan, the volume of slide was about 50×104 m3, the maximum sliding distance was 40 m, and about 10×104 m3 of sliding body substances ran into the river to block more than half the river (about 40 m), sliding materials diverted the river, which caused collapse of public housing and destruction of related facilities, giving rise to large economic losses. Based on geology and precipitation data, the paper analyzed comprehensively the formation mechanism of the landslide and explained the reasons for the formation of the disaster.The landslide resulted from many factors, but the role of each factor is different.The main factors are storm water, geological conditions favorable for slide occurrence, and irrational human activities. Powerful rain played an erosion, jacking, wedge cracking, motivate role. The occurrence of landslide involves the following four steps:namely groundwater convergence-jacking the landslide body, river rise-scouring the foot, squeeze-wedge crack and collapse crack-slide. It has provided some guidance for preventing and governing disaster risks in Southwest China, so as to further study the formation conditions and presence mechanism of Gufeng Village landslide in Fankuai town.
